I've managed to bend some pins on my trusty old 3500+, which I've had since S939 first emerged, and after struggling to get them back in place (with many expletives) I've given up and decided I might as well upgrade the thing.

Looking around at what's currently available, I thought the Opteron 180 looked like a good bet. Same default clock speeds as my 3500+ but am I right in thinking each core has an extra 512kb of cache?

I ran my 3500+ at 2420, which I believe is 3700+ speeds. How well do the Opteron's clock, and do you think it's worthwhile getting a more expensive one (Opty180 is ~£100) over a cheaper A64 dual core?
